The story of John F Whitehead began in 1853 in Texas, USA. In 1860, John F Whitehead resided in Bare Creek, Sabine, Texas, USA. In 1880, John F Whitehead resided in Precinct 3, Sabine, Texas, United States. John F Whitehead married Matilda Ellis Goodman, and had children including Ann Whitehead, Arizona E Whitehead, Ella Whitehead, John F Whitehead, Linnie M Whitehead, Lula Whitehead, Martin L Whitehead, Mary Jane Whitehead, Maud B Whitehead, Narry Austin Whitehead, Ollie May Whitehead, William Whitehead. John F Whitehead passed away in 1926 in Pineland, Sabine County, Texas, USA.
